4 prong range cord lowe's

For example: It is easy to see that when substituted into the previous SQL statement, this “title” will result in always selecting all films. the Sakila database: Again, the information of interest is wrapped between delimiters. 1.1 We use Google Dork string to find Vulnerable SQLMAP SQL injectable website. Landfill does not include surface impoundment, waste pile, land … Let’s change our service again, executing the vulnerable query but without returning any data: My log file shows me that there are many more SQL statements executed by sqlmap and even the confirmation if there is a vulnerability at the given URL takes longer, as sqlmap now resorts to binary searches using delays. Finding-the-DBMS: We can find out DBMS type (MS-SQL, MYSQL, ORACLE) by using the unique functions of the appropriate database. This is a lot slower and more visible in server logs than before, but it can still produce the result. * for ruby application, take a look at brakeman. It comes with a powerful detection engine, many niche features for the ultimate penetration tester and a broad range of switches lasting from database fingerprinting, over data fetching from the database, to accessing the underlying file system and … On collection day all containers should Intruders have time. when accessing the file system. Let’s dump the film table: More elaborate countermeasures can be achieved by lots of training, screening, testing, and using entry servers. The user can also choose to dump only a range of characters from each column's entry. For this, we’ll add the –dbs parameter on the same URL: This will immediately dump the following databases: Note that sqlmap logs everything it learns in a local SQLite database, such that it can keep the number of HTTP requests as small as possible. For instance, web users are granted access to a few read-only views, never to tables directly. For example, if users can make a choice in an HTML dropdown. We are going to use Google Dork string is “ inurl:index.php?id= ”. Basic Operation of SQLMAP & enumeration of Server through automatic SQL Injection. --dump Here again options -T table_name , -D database_name and --exclude-sysdbs can be used to limit extracted data. But the threat doesn’t end there. on the day of collection. Carefully craft database GRANTs and security policies. These languages are less vulnerable than SQL because they’re less expressive. Nothing prevents this user input from being a SQL code snippet that would make perfect sense syntactically. This is important for an attacker, as frequent HTTP 404 or 500 statuses will eventually trigger attention by maintenance personnel at the server side. -T: Specify the table name, -D: Specifies the library name. an HTML field. Let’s explore it further. Instead of simply embedding the HTTP POST parameter value into your SQL statement, parse it first and encapsulate it in an appropriate pre-defined type. Fully supports six SQL injection techniques: boolean-based blind technique, error-based technique, … Mostly likely there is also a userID or LogonId in there we need to extract as well. Enter your email address to follow this blog and receive notifications of new posts by email. Hot Network Questions How can you trust that there is no backdoor in your hardware? The disadvantage of this feature is the fact that it can be quite difficult to implement a modern JavaScript-based rich internet application because… you cannot modify GET parameters. Learn how your comment data is processed. python sqlmap.py -u “url” –dump -T “users” -D “testdb”. And, is it easy to create injecting malicious SQL command into SQL statement to steal sensitive data in database via web page? Apart from simple regular-expression based pattern matching (which is not really reliable or useful), such an entry server should also support two very powerful features to help you prevent mistakes when accepting user input through HTTP GET and POST parameters: An example of an entry server implementing the above is Airlock by a Swiss company called Ergon Informatik AG. Trash Pick-upThe Bureau of Sanitation services four automated trash containers: black (for household refuse) blue (for recyclables) green (for yard trimmings) and brown (for horse manure) containers.Containers must be placed at the curb by 6:00a.m. This site uses Akismet to reduce spam. In millions of lines of application code, it can be sufficient if one SQL vulnerability is detected by a malicious entity operating with automated tools, such as sqlmap. If you are an engineering team leader, it is your responsibility to help your team members avoid such mistakes. 4. the name of the column whose data we want to extract I have been hired by a tech company but the contract states all my work is their IP Is the word ноябрь or its forms ever abbreviated in Russian language? They can run their script over a week to have sqlmap dump your complete database schema. Sqlmap can help in avoiding writing scripts, thus exploiting much faster. But the Little Bobby Tables example is not what most intruders are after anyway: Causing damage to your system. It is free and Open Source, available under the GPLv2 license. First heard of it via https://github.com/garethr/pentesting-playground, Counteractions, you can perhaps also add JDBC drivers (if you’re operating with Java) and databases have very few bugs in that area, such that streaming bind variables to the database will not generate any easily exploitable vulnerability. In three steps: Let’s look at step 2. SQLMap is … on the day of collection and removed no later than 8:00p.m. If you’re developing a web application, you can choose from a variety of firewalls that have some SQL injection protection features. Form Protection: All acceptable values that can be chosen in a form are known to the entry server and validated using an encrypted hash. It is thus impossible to tamper with GET parameters. You can use it in your continuous integration test suites to detect SQL injection regressions. Yet, many development teams are unaware of the magnitude of this threat. Meier, Alex Mackman, Michael Dunner, Srinath Vasireddy, Ray Escamilla and Anandha Murukan of the Microsoft Corporation, “SQL Injection Prevention Cheat Sheet” of OWASP, “SQL Injection” of The Web Application Security Consortium, “SQL Injection” of Wikipedia (with lots of links), https://github.com/garethr/pentesting-playground, 3 Reasons why You Shouldn't Replace Your for-loops by Stream.forEach(), How to Write a Multiplication Aggregate Function in SQL, How to Create a Range From 1 to 10 in SQL, How to Calculate Multiple Aggregate Functions in a Single Query. sqlmap is an open source penetration testing software that automates the process of detecting and exploiting SQL injection flaws and taking over of database servers. In principle, it is almost impossible to completely prevent vulnerabilities involving SQL. SELECT table_name FROM information_schema.tables WHERE table_schema=database () and table_name LIKE 'w%'; Actually above query is almost same the native SQLMap payloads. Let’s try to change our application such that it will display a simple 500 Internal Server Error message: No problem for sqlmap. ; I guess I could of showed you this option earlier, but good things come to those who wait. Obviously, “threatening” user input can still originate from regular or